Yes , I think that they came fitted with 383mm Ohlins remote reservoirs . I am looking for a pipe off a '78 CR390, to put on my '77 model, if anyone has one laying around . The '77 pipe has a big bulky muffler section built into the pipe (that burns your leg & the seatcover), where the '78 has a narrow stinger section with a seperate muffler on the end.
-
As stated elsewhere on this forum..1978 250 and 390 shocks are 15 1/8 long..whatever that is in mm..the 390 's came with Ohlins and the 250 had gas girlings on them...
